This paper summarizes the author’s presentation at the 26th Annual Conference of the Academia Europaea, Barcelona, July 2014. ; Erasmus Lecture 2014 ; Robots are no longer confined to factories; they are progressively spreading to urban, social and assistive domains. In order to become handy co-workers and helpful assistants, they must be endowed with quite different abilities from their industrial ancestors. Research on service robots aims to make them intrinsically safe to people, easy to teach by non-experts, able to manipulate not only rigid but also deformable objects, and highly adaptable to non-predefined and dynamic environments. Robots worldwide will share object and environmental models, their acquired knowledge and experiences through global databases and, together with the internet of things, will strongly change the citizens' way of life in so-called smart cities. This raises a number of social and ethical issues that are now being debated not only within the Robotics community but by society at large. ; The described research has been partially supported by the European projects PACO-PLUS (IST-FP6-IP-027657), GARNICS (FP7-ICT-247947) and IntellAct (FP7-ICT-269959), and the Spanish project PAU + (DPI2011-27510). ; Peer Reviewed
